I'm very pessimistic that the Soviets would be able to restore and operate that many NATO vehicles. Panthers weren't that far technically from T-34's, M1A1 and Leopards are something else. All the high-tech goodies would seem to be irreplaceable.

The Soviets have been very good historically at reverse-engineering captured stuff, but in 1997-98, when this might happen (using stuff captured during the drive back across Poland), that seems a waste of time & effort to try and rebuild the computer elements.

IMO, anyway.

On second thought, I think my objection is more that there would not be enough operating to fill a TO&E like you have. I can definitely see some running vehicles here and there, and perhaps more turned into static defenses.
